What is the OSD Certificate?
The OSD (Austrian Language Diploma German) is a state-approved assessment and assessment system for German as a Foreign Language and German as a Second Language. Founded in 1994 on the effort of the Austrian Federal Ministries, the OSD is headquartered in Vienna. While its origins are Austrian, the certificate is designed to show the pluricentric nature of the German language. This means it acknowledges and includes the linguistic variations of German spoken in Austria, Germany, and Switzerland.

The OSD evaluations are strictly lined up with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), guaranteeing that the credentials is understood and respected throughout international borders.

The OSD tests are developed to evaluate 4 core competencies: Reading, Listening, Writing, and Speaking. Depending on the level, the exam might be modular, suggesting the written and oral components can be taken and passed separately.
Exam Components and Duration
The period and complexity of the exam boost with each level. Below is a general breakdown of what prospects can anticipate during the screening process.
Exam ComponentDescription of TasksApproximated Time (Level [ÖSD Prüfung B2 In Deutschland](https://xegames.online/osd-zertifikat8794))ReadingUnderstanding various texts (news articles, brochures, advertisements) and answering understanding questions.90 minutesListeningListening to dialogues, radio broadcasts, or presentations and determining essential information.Thirty minutesComposingProducing structured texts such as official letters, emails, or essays based upon specific prompts.90 minutesSpeakingTaking part in a conversation, making a brief discussion, or taking part in a debate with an examiner.15-- 20 minutesThe Modular System
For levels like [B1 Zertifikat Kaufen](http://157.66.191.31:3000/osd4308q), B2, and C1, the OSD uses a modular approach. This is highly beneficial for candidates because if a participant passes the "Reading" and "Listening" modules however fails "Writing," they just need to duplicate the Writing module within a particular timeframe to get the full certificate.

Q: Is the OSD certificate valid in Germany?A: Yes. The OSD certificate is acknowledged in Germany, Austria, and Switzerland for university admission and by numerous employers. Particularly, the OSD B1 is developed in cooperation with the Goethe-Institut and corresponds their B1 exam.

Q: How many times can I retake the exam?A: There is no limitation to how lots of times a candidate can retake an OSD exam. Nevertheless, candidates need to pay the full or modular charge for each effort.

Q: Can I take the OSD exam online?A: Currently, OSD exams should be taken at authorized, physical exam centers to ensure the stability of the testing environment and the identity of the prospects.

Q: What is the difference between OSD and the Goethe-Zertifikat?A: Both are globally recognized certificates. The primary difference lies in the organization: OSD is based in Austria, while Goethe is based in Germany. The OSD often consists of more Austrian and Swiss linguistic variations in its products compared to the Goethe-Zertifikat.

Q: Is there an age limitation for the examinations?A: General OSD tests are normally advised for prospects aged 16 and older. For [Zertifikat Deutsch](https://git.genowisdom.cn/osd-b1-zertifikat6833) more youthful learners, the OSD KID (ages 10-14) is more proper.
